Chanshuai Han is a scholar working on Molecular Biology, Neurology and Physiology. According to data from OpenAlex, Chanshuai Han has authored 15 papers receiving a total of 602 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Molecular Biology, 6 papers in Neurology and 5 papers in Physiology. Recurrent topics in Chanshuai Han’s work include Neuroinflammation and Neurodegeneration Mechanisms (6 papers), Alzheimer's disease research and treatments (3 papers) and Advanced Glycation End Products research (3 papers). Chanshuai Han is often cited by papers focused on Neuroinflammation and Neurodegeneration Mechanisms (6 papers), Alzheimer's disease research and treatments (3 papers) and Advanced Glycation End Products research (3 papers). Chanshuai Han collaborates with scholars based in Canada, China and Germany. Chanshuai Han's co-authors include Rongqiao He, Zhiqian Tong, Wenhong Luo, Hongjun Luo, Jiang‐Ning Zhou, Wei Yan, Hui Li, Jin‐Shun Qi, Xiaohui Wang and Yang Lü and has published in prestigious journals such as PLoS ONE, Scientific Reports and The FASEB Journal.
